OpenSSL和Python实现RSA Key数字签名和验证,基于非对称算法的RSA Key主要有两个用途,数字签名和验证(私钥签名,公钥验证),以及非对称加解密(公钥加密,私钥解密)。本文提供一个基于OpenSSL命令行和Python的数字签名和验证过程的例子,另外会另起一篇使用OpenSSL和Python进行非对称加解密的例子。

1. OpenSSL实现数字签名和验证

1.1 生成私钥

生成2048 bit的PEM格式的RSA Key:Key.pem

# 生成私钥文件Key.pem

$ openssl genrsa -out Key.pem -f4 2048

1.2 导出公钥

从私钥导出公钥:Key_pub.pem

# 从私钥导出公钥,很简单,使用参数-pubout就可以

$ openssl rsa -in Key.pem -pubout -out Key_pub.pem
